water conservation has become an increasingly essential aspect of many industrial processes in recent years as companies strive to reduce emissions and save budgets. one of the key technologies that play a significant role in improving industrial water recovery is the filter press.


filter presses are a type of equipment used to extract liquids from solids by applying force to the mixture, forcing the liquid through a filter medium and leaving the solids behind. this process is called filtration and it is a crucial step in any water conservation operation as it allows for the recovery of clean water from contaminated water streams.


filter presses can be used in a wide range of applications including chemical processing, mining, food and beverage and various other branches where water recycling is critical. the equipment can handle varying types and amounts of solid waste, from small amounts of sand and sediment to larger quantities of mud and solids.


one of the primary benefits of filter presses in facilitating industrial water conservation is their ability to generate valuable products from the waste materials they process. for instance, in the mining sector, filter presses can be used to extract gold from tailings, a type of waste material generated during the mining process.


filter presses are also used to reduce the volume of industrial effluent discharged into the environment, thereby helping companies achieve compliance with environmental laws. by recovering clean water and generating valuable derivatives, filter presses enable companies to minimize their water usage, reduce their operating expenses, and promote sustainable development.


another significant advantage of filter presses is their ability to improve the quality of recovered water. in this process, the equipment removes other impurities, producing a high-quality water that can be reused in different industrial operations. this contributes to a sustainable system where water can be used multiple times, reducing the need for fresh water and minimizing wastewater generation.
